Quantum-mechanical simulation of attosecond streaked photoemission from Mg-covered W(110) surfaces
Creators
- 1. Department of Physics, Kansas State University, Manhattan, Kansas 66506 (United States)
Description
We apply a quantum-mechanical model to simulate infrared-streaked photoelectron emission by an ultrashort extreme ultraviolet pulse from adsorbate-covered metal surfaces. Incorporating effects of energy- dependent electron mean-free paths, the properties of initial states, photoelectron energy dispersion, and the screening of the streaking field, this model is able to reproduce recently measured photoelectron spectrograms and adsorbate-thickness-dependent photoemission time delays.
